SPANISH RICE RECIPE



Spanish Rice Recipe image

This Spanish Rice recipe is quick, easy and has so much flavor packed into every single bite. It's perfectly fluffy, uses just a few simple ingredients and tastes just like it came from your favorite restaurant.

Provided by Jill Baird

Categories     Side Dish

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 tablespoons Olive Oil (can substitute any cooking oil)
2 cups Long Grain White Rice
1/2 small Yellow Onion (or 1/4 cup diced, can substitute white)
1 tsp Salt
3 cups Chicken Broth (can substitute vegetable broth)
1 cup Salsa (your favorite brand)
1 large Lime (cut into segments)

Steps:

  • In a large frying pan on medium heat, add the oil and the rice. Stirring occasionally, cook the rice until golden brown, or about 3-5 minutes.
  • Add the diced onion and salt and cook for another 1-2 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Add the chicken broth and salsa and stir. Bring the mixture up to a boil, then cover with a lid and reduce heat to low. Keep the rice at a low simmer for 20 minutes, without removing the lid if possible. After 20 minutes, lift the lid and check your rice but do not stir. You may need to cook for up to 5 more minutes, or until all of the liquid has absorbed and the rice is cooked.
  • Once cooked completely, turn the heat off and let it sit for 10 minutes, then lightly fluff with a fork and squeeze the fresh lime juice on the rice before serving. Enjoy!

RESTAURANT STYLE SPANISH RICE



Restaurant Style Spanish Rice image

This flavorful rice recipe goes with almost any dinner! Or use it as a topping for tacos or burritos or in a taco bowl!

Provided by Dan

Categories     Side Dish

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 tablespoon butter
1/2 cup diced onion
1 teaspoon chopped garlic
2 cups white rice
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 teaspoon ground cumin
2 1/2 cups chicken stock
8 ounces tomato sauce
Chopped cilantro for garnish (optional)

Steps:

  • Add the oil and butter to a 3 quart dutch oven or wide, heavy bottomed pot over medium-low heat.
  • Add the onion and cook for 5 minutes to soften, then add the garlic and cook for 1 minute longer.
  • Pour in the rice, stir and cook for 7-8 minutes, stirring often, until sightly browned. Add the salt, pepper and cumin, stirring to combine.
  • Slowly pour in the ch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Stir the rice to make sure it isn't sticking to the bottom of the pot, then turn the heat down to the lowest setting and cover.
  • Cook the rice for 10 minutes, then add the tomato sauce. Stir to combine and cover for another 5 minutes. Turn the heat off and let the rice sit, covered for another 5 minutes.
  • Remove the lid and fluff the rice with a fork. Garnish with chopped cilantro or parsley if desired and serve.

RESTAURANT SPANISH RICE



Restaurant Spanish Rice image

This is a simple flavorful rice that I came up with to as a compromise for my picky eater daughter. It closely resembles the rice served at the local Mexican restaurants in San Diego.

Provided by puppitypup

Categories     Rice

Time 35m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 teaspoon olive oil
1 teaspoon butter
1/2 sweet onion, diced
1 cup rice
2 cups water
1 chicken bouillon cube
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t (less if regular salt)
1/4 cup mild canned enchilada sauce (not salsa)
1 -2 tablespoon grated carrot
1 -2 green onion, for garnish

Steps:

  • Saute onion in oil until translucent.
  • Add rice and saute a few more minutes.
  • Add remaining ingredients and bring to a boil.
  • Stir, cover and reduce heat to simmer.
  • Simmer for twenty minutes without removing lid.
  • Fluff with a fork and serve with chopped green onions on top.
  • Note: The mild enchilada sauce adds flavor without adding spiciness. If using hot enchilada sauce, I would cut the amount in half at least.

AUTHENTIC SPANISH RICE



Authentic Spanish Rice image

Make and share this Authentic Spanish Rice recipe from Food.com.

Provided by catalinacrawler

Categories     Spanish

Time 25m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 1/2 cups long grain white rice
2 garlic cloves, minced
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1/4 cup onion, finely diced
4 ounces el pato salsa fresca (or tomato sauce if you cant find el pato sauce)
2 1/2 cups chicken broth
1 teaspoon cumin
1 tablespoon chili powder
1/2 teaspoon sea salt
pepper

Steps:

  • in a bowl combine broth, cumin, chili powder, salt & half a can of el pato sauce (if you can't find el pato use regular tomato sauce).
  • brown rice, in hot oil, in a large skillet for approximately 5 minutes flipping occasionally.
  • add diced onion, minced garlic, sauté for 1 minute.
  • add seasoned broth, bring to a boil.
  • reduce heat to low, cover and simmer for 15 minutes. do not check on the rice before the 15 minutes is up, this will allow steam to escape and may make your rice turn out undercooked.
  • most of the water will absorb before the 15 minute time limit but keep covered and continue to steam for the entire 15 minutes. this will make for perfect rice that isnt crunchy.
  • after 15 minutes turn heat off, uncover & flip rice over. recover & let sit until everything else is ready. you can let the rice sit covered for up to 25 minutes which will cook out most of the moisture & leave perfect fluffy rice.
